Estimate your payment with the Payment Calculator. WebSince Windows 10, two files are used – pagefile.sys and swapfile.sys They always work together and are stored in the root of the C:\ drive. To view them, you need to enable the display of hidden and system files and folders. To do this, open the C:\ drive, select the “ View ” tab and check the “ Hidden Items ” box
